Time to Rejoice For All Seafood Lovers as Ban on Fishing Ends & Boats Are Back With Fresh Catch
The ban on deep sea fishing on Mangalore & Udupi districts for two months ended on July 31. The fishermen who had ventured into the sea from August 1, are returning with their prized catch from the deep sea to the Old Port, which is well known as Bunder/ Dhakke in Mangalore. The fishermen get the fresh catch which are being sold at reasonable rates and tickling the taste buds of fish lovers. Though fishermen were worried about the inclement weather, clear skies in August have brought cheer due to a good catch.
Bunder/Dhakke is now filled with workers unloading fish from boats to ice into boxes and trucks categorising the catch into varieties for domestic and export markets. This year’s main catch so far is seer fish, mackerel, sardines, cuttlefish, kite fish, tiger prawns and crabs.
